Why Is LeBaron Russell Briggs Influential?
(Suggest an Edit or Addition)According to Wikipedia, LeBaron Russell Briggs was an American educator. He was appointed the first dean of men at Harvard College, and subsequently served as dean of the faculty until he retired. He was concurrently president of Radcliffe College and the National Collegiate Athletic Association.
